Improving Nighttime Driving Clarity and Security

LED headlight bulbs have emerged as vital for modern vehicles, providing unmatched brightness and clarity. Unlike traditional halogen bulbs, they generate a crisper, whiter light that closely resembles natural daylight. This significant improvement enables motorists to identify hazards earlier, respond promptly, and maneuver challenging conditions with confidence. Research indicates that vehicles equipped with LED headlight bulbs reduce nighttime accidents by approximately one-fifth, underscoring their critical safety benefits.

Additionally, the precise light distribution of LED headlight bulbs reduces eye strain for oncoming drivers, creating a safer communal driving space. Whether driving through wet roads, misty terrain, or unlit routes, these bulbs maintain reliable functionality, guaranteeing optimal visibility at all times.

Energy Efficiency and Longevity: A Sustainable Choice

Among the most persuasive arguments for LED headlight bulbs lies in their exceptional power-saving capability. Traditional halogen bulbs waste large quantities of electricity as heat, while LED variants transform over 80% of power usage into light. This dramatic reduction in energy demand doesn’t just reduces vehicle fuel consumption but also extends battery longevity in eco-friendly vehicles.

In addition, the lifespan of LED headlight bulbs exceeds conventional alternatives by a wide margin. While halogen bulbs function for approximately 500–1,000 hours, LED versions can operate for up to 30,000 hours under normal conditions. This longevity translates to fewer replacements, saving drivers both time and money in the years ahead.

Withstanding Extreme Environments Reliably

LED headlight bulbs are engineered to withstand harsh environments that could compromise ordinary bulbs. Built with durable materials, they eliminate fragile filaments or brittle housings, making them immune to shaking, physical shocks, and temperature fluctuations. Whether driving through rocky terrains or experiencing freezing temperatures, these bulbs retain consistent output free from interruptions.

Moreover, their resistance to moisture ingress and particle buildup secures dependable functionality in adverse weather. Unlike halogen bulbs, that can malfunction if subjected to heavy rain or sandstorms, LED headlight bulbs remain unaffected, delivering uninterrupted illumination irrespective of environmental factors.

Cost-Effectiveness Over Time

Although the initial investment for LED headlight bulbs may seem higher compared to traditional options, their eventual financial benefits establish them as a wise economic choice. As noted earlier, their prolonged durability eliminates the need for frequent replacements, reducing upkeep costs substantially. Moreover, their low-power operation decreases fuel or battery consumption, translating to additional savings over months and years.

Another financial perk stems from their adaptability to contemporary automotive technologies. Many newer cars incorporate auto-dimming features or intelligent detectors that optimize light distribution based on road circumstances. These advanced units integrate seamlessly with these innovations, preventing expensive modifications or system incompatibilities.

Performance in Extreme Temperatures

A frequently ignored advantage of LED headlight bulbs is their ability to perform seamlessly in extreme temperatures. Traditional halogen bulbs struggle in scorching climates, overheating and dimming, while sub-zero weather may lead to cracking or malfunction. In contrast, LED headlight bulbs thrive in such extremes, preserving peak luminosity without sacrifice.

This resilience originates from their superior heat dissipation systems, which channel surplus warmth from vital parts. Even during extended operation, they stay safe to handle, preventing thermal damage and ensuring durable service. For drivers in areas experiencing severe weather, this feature is indispensable.
